Organised labour on Monday accused the Federal Government of failing in its responsibility of ensuring the protection of lives and property of the Nigerian citizenry. President of the Nigeria Labour Congress, Mr. Abdulwahed Omar; and his counterpart in the Trade Union Congress, Mr. Bobboi Kaigama, said that the bombings, killings, assassinations, kidnappings and other vices in the society had become rather disturbing. In a joint Independence anniversary statement, Omar and Kaigama lamented that the ugly scenes that were only seen in movies had become daily occurrences in the country and that the situation seemed to have overwhelmed the government.
